My thinking is, a hen that pushes both good and bad eggs out of a nest might be expressing what little is left of an old trait. Now most chickens are hatched in incubators, but I would imagine when brooding a hen that doesn't remove rotting eggs wouldn't get to pass on it's genes. I haven't hatched enough eggs under hens to know for sure, but so far I have yet had a rotten egg kill a clutch.
